首页 | 新闻 | 新品 | 文库 | 方案 | 视频 | 下载 | 商城 | 开发板 | 数据中心 | 座谈新版 | 培训 | 工具 | 博客 | 论坛 | 百科 | GEC | 活动 | 主题月 | 电子展
返回列表 回复 发帖

嵌入式软件系统关于面向对象编程的艰难之路

嵌入式软件系统关于面向对象编程的艰难之路


嵌入式代码大多数都是用C语言写的,C语言是基于过程的开发语言,结构性比较差,代码量小的时候还比较方便接受,可读性维护性较好,
代码量达到百万行后,开发和维护都非常困难,整体的架构就显得不够清晰,变量结构体复杂繁多,过程函数重复臃肿,改一个地方,都伤筋动骨,大动干戈,兴师动众,难以维护。
而将基于面向对象的思想加载于现有的复杂系统上,又显得困难重重,难以实施,路漫漫而艰难
返回列表